Middle/Senior C++ Developer

Местоположение и тип занятости

Полный рабочий деньМожно удаленно

Компания

Разработка и производство продукции и решений для морской отрасли и ВПК

Описание вакансии

С++ у нас используется в ряде проектов, самые масштабные из них:

  • разработка серверных и GUI компонентов для судов, в том числе в рамках направления автономного судовождения;
  • cоздание цифровой экосистемы e-Navigation – разработка и внедрение сервисов, предназначенных для объединения в единое информационное пространство;

Масштабы проектов дают возможность применить и развить свои профессиональные навыки по многим направлениям: web-сервисы, распределенные десктопные приложения, бортовые программные продукты.

У нас:

  • продуктовая разработка;
  • современный стек технологий;
  • гибкие методологии;
  • построенные и постоянно совершенствующиеся процессы контроля качества и CI/CD.

Предстоящие задачи:

  • Разработка и поддержка программных продуктов на C++.
  • Поддержка, развитие и повышение качества существующей кодовой базы;
  • Проведение ревью кода.

От будущего коллеги мы ожидаем:

  • Опыт разработки на С++ от 3-х лет (серверное ПО и/или desktop-приложения);
  • Высокий уровень владения С++;
  • Опыт использования библиотек Qt, boost;
  • Понимание принципов ООП;
  • Умение писать понятный, сопровождаемый код, разбираться и работать с чужим кодом;
  • Опыт кроссплатформенной разработки (Windows/Linux);
  • Опыт работы с базами данных;
  • Знание сетевых технологий (UDP/TCP);
  • Опыт работы с GIT;
  • Английский язык на уровне чтения технической документации.

    Бонусы

    • Гибкий подход к графику работы и возможность полной удаленки;
    • ДМС + стоматология + офисный врач;
    • Соблюдение всех норм ТК РФ;
    • Возможность проходить обучение, повышать квалификацию, участвовать в выставках и профильных мероприятиях
    • Онлайн-библиотека Alpina Digital.